Throughout the popular films, Shrek is depicted as a towering, intimidating character. His broad shoulders and stout figure create an imposing presence. However, determining his precise height is not as straightforward as it may seem.
According to various sources, Shrek is said to be approximately seven feet tall, or 84 inches. This measurement is based on his appearance next to other characters and objects throughout the movies. When standing next to average-sized humans, Shrek is shown as significantly taller, reinforcing the perception of his immense stature.
Furthermore, it is worth noting that Shrek’s exact height may vary from one film to another. In some scenes, he appears taller than in others, which adds to the difficulty of determining his true height. Yet, the consensus among fans and movie experts is that Shrek stands around seven feet tall.
However, it is essential to remember that Shrek’s height is purely imaginary. As an animated character, he does not adhere to the laws of physics or possess the proportions of a real-life being. The creators of Shrek intentionally designed him to be exaggerated and larger than life, emphasizing his ogre nature.
Taking a step beyond the movies, Shrek’s height is also a subject of debate among those interested in the character’s origins. In William Steig’s original 1990 children’s book, Shrek, there is no mention of his height. The characterization of Shrek as a giant ogre came about when DreamWorks adapted the story for the big screen.
